Description: The year 1889 marks the beginning of Mombasa’s first “catholic mission”. Fr. Alexandre Le Roy, a French Holy Ghost Missionary (C.S.Sp), is considered the pioneer of this initiative. The first baptism took place on August 14, 1889, when Maria, the infant daughter of Diego and Natalie Pereira, was received into the Christian community.
